This updated version of draft-ietf-openpgp-nist-bp-comp-04 fixes a
number of internal and external reference inconsistencies of the draft
and adds some clarifications, but makes no actual changes to the spec.
For convenience, I post here the list of changes:
Added the requirement to perform full public key validation on received
EC points in the ECDH-KEM operations, and a corresponding security
consideration regarding invalid-curve attacks.

Fixed errors in the IANA table: ECDH secret key length for P-521 (66
instead of 64 octets), ML-KEM-1024 public key labels, and a wrong table
reference for the ECDH secret key format.

Corrected the description of the placement of the symmetric algorithm
identifier in v3 PKESK packets to match the wire format and [RFC9980].

Fixed the mislabeled reference to FIPS 186-5 (previously labeled as SP
800-186) and cite FIPS 186-5 Appendix A for EC key generation.

Decryption procedure: clarified that ecdhPublicKey is taken from the
public key part of the own secret key packet.

Removed a stale editor's note above the IANA table.

Update reference I-D.draft-ietf-openpgp-pqc to RFC 9980

Change email address of one author.

Internet-Draft draft-ietf-openpgp-nist-bp-comp-04.txt is now available.
It is a work item of the Open Specification for Pretty Good Privacy
(OPENPGP) WG of the IETF.
> 

Title: PQ/T Composite Schemes for OpenPGP using NIST and Brainpool
Elliptic Curve Domain Parameters Authors: Quynh Dang Stephan Ehlen
Stavros Kousidis Johannes Roth Falko Strenzke Name: draft-ietf-openpgp-
nist-bp-comp-04.txt Pages: 93 Dates: 2026-08-11
> 

Abstract:
> 

This document defines PQ/T ("post-quantum/traditional") composite
schemes based on ML-KEM and ML-DSA combined with ECDH and ECDSA
algorithms using the NIST and Brainpool domain parameters for the
OpenPGP protocol [RFC9580], and as such extends [RFC9980].
